About awesome-mcp-servers

TensorBlock/awesome-mcp-servers

A comprehensive collection of Model Context Protocol (MCP) servers

This is a curated collection of Model Context Protocol (MCP) servers, which act like universal adapters for AI models. It helps AI users connect their AI assistants, research agents, or other AI tools to a vast array of external services like databases, web browsers, communication platforms, and more. If you're using an AI model and need it to interact with real-world data or services, this list provides the specific 'server' connections you need.

About awesome-osint-mcp-servers

soxoj/awesome-osint-mcp-servers

A curated list of OSINT MCP servers. Pull requests are welcomed!

This is a curated list of tools and services that help you gather publicly available information for investigations, security research, or competitive analysis. It focuses on 'MCP servers' which connect these tools to AI assistants like Claude, allowing you to use natural language queries to execute OSINT tasks and generate reports. This resource is for intelligence analysts, security researchers, or anyone needing to collect and analyze open-source data efficiently.
